如何設(shè)置MySQL允許遠(yuǎn)程連接
MySQL默認(rèn)情況下是不允許被遠(yuǎn)程連接的,只有本地機(jī)器才能連接。但是在某些情況下,我們需要通過(guò)遠(yuǎn)程連接來(lái)管理和操作MySQL數(shù)據(jù)庫(kù)。本文將介紹如何設(shè)置MySQL允許遠(yuǎn)程連接的方法。查看可安裝的MySQ
MySQL默認(rèn)情況下是不允許被遠(yuǎn)程連接的,只有本地機(jī)器才能連接。但是在某些情況下,我們需要通過(guò)遠(yuǎn)程連接來(lái)管理和操作MySQL數(shù)據(jù)庫(kù)。本文將介紹如何設(shè)置MySQL允許遠(yuǎn)程連接的方法。
查看可安裝的MySQL版本
首先,在Linux上我們需要查看可以安裝的MySQL版本。使用以下命令來(lái)查看可安裝的版本:
```shell
rpm -qa | grep mysql
```
這將顯示出可安裝的MySQL版本列表。
安裝MySQL
接著,根據(jù)上一步中查看到的可安裝的MySQL版本,使用以下命令進(jìn)行安裝:
```shell
yum install -y mysql-server mysql mysql-devel
```
安裝完成后,如果出現(xiàn)"Complete"字樣,則表示安裝成功。
啟動(dòng)MySQL服務(wù)
然后,我們需要啟動(dòng)MySQL服務(wù)。使用以下命令來(lái)啟動(dòng)MySQL服務(wù):
```shell
service mysqld start
```
如果看到兩個(gè)"OK"字樣,則表示啟動(dòng)成功。
登錄MySQL
接下來(lái),我們需要登錄MySQL。使用以下命令登錄MySQL:
```shell
mysql -u root -p
```
然后輸入登錄密碼,如果成功登錄則表示可以使用MySQL。
開(kāi)啟允許遠(yuǎn)程連接
接下來(lái),我們需要開(kāi)啟MySQL允許遠(yuǎn)程連接的功能。首先,查看防火墻的情況,使用以下命令來(lái)查看是否已經(jīng)開(kāi)放了3306端口:
```shell
netstat -ntpl
```
如果沒(méi)有看到3306端口,則需要添加該端口。
然后,在登錄MySQL后,使用以下命令來(lái)給遠(yuǎn)程用戶授權(quán)并允許遠(yuǎn)程連接:
```sql
grant all privileges on *.* to 'root'@'你的IP地址' identified by '你的密碼' with grant option;
```
記得刷新服務(wù)以使更改生效。
遠(yuǎn)程連接MySQL
最后,我們可以在其他機(jī)器上使用Navicat等工具來(lái)進(jìn)行遠(yuǎn)程連接和訪問(wèn)MySQL數(shù)據(jù)庫(kù)了。只需輸入正確的IP地址、用戶名和密碼即可遠(yuǎn)程管理和操作MySQL數(shù)據(jù)庫(kù)。
通過(guò)以上步驟,您已成功設(shè)置MySQL允許遠(yuǎn)程連接,并可以方便地進(jìn)行遠(yuǎn)程管理和操作。